| Title: | Anticancer activity of sclerotiorin, isolated from an endophytic fungus Cephalotheca faveolata Yaguchi, Nishim. & Udagawa |

| Abstract: | Biodiversity provides critical
support for drug discovery. A significant proportion of drugs are derived,
directly or indirectly, from biological sources. Through high throughput screening (HTS) and
bioassay-guided isolation, bioactive compound sclerotiorin has been isolated from
an endophytic fungus Cephalotheca
faveolata. Sclerotiorin was found to be potent anti-proliferative against
different cancer cells. In this study sclerotiorin has been found to induce
apoptosis in colon cancer (HCT-116) cells through the activation of BAX, and
down-regulation of BCL-2, those further activated cleaved caspase-3 causing
apoptosis of cancer cells. |
